Transaction 8304d7e520ac491348e5d54bcd435e8fc70b81176c18ad168f94aa7b3c1e73ea
1 Input
1 Output
-
8304d7e520ac491348e5d54bcd435e8fc70b81176c18ad168f94aa7b3c1e73ea:0
- value
- 145303
- script pubkey
- OP_0 OP_PUSHBYTES_20 04c44e0553117bf7dc82dd86830a270940f0d500
- address
- bc1qqnzyup2nz9al0hyzmkrgxz38p9q0p4gqcrpwdj